Cyprus President Nicos Anastasiades attends European Council summit in Brussels where UK Prime Minister Theresa May will urge EU leaders to give her more time to get her Brexit deal through the door.


Anastasiades is in Brussels to participate in the European Council summit to be held on 21 and 22 March.

EU leaders will tell May on Thursday she can have two months to organise an orderly Brexit but Britain could face a hugely disruptive ejection from the bloc next Friday if the prime minister fails to win backing from parliament

EU diplomats said her request for a delay until June 30 seemed likely to be met by an EU preference for Britain to have completed formalities and begin a status-quo transition to departure before Europeans elect a new parliament from May 23.

Also, on the summit’s agenda will be Brexit, the Multiannual Financial Framework, Migration, Climate Change and EU External Relations. The Council will also make preparations in view of the EU-China Summit to take place on 9 April.

The President is accompanied by Government Spokesman Prodromos and returns to Cyprus on March 22.
